Difference between revisions of "BridgeInterface/fr"

From SME Server
Jump to navigationJump to search
m
Line 15: Line 15:
 
=== Exigences ===
 
=== Exigences ===
 
*SME Server 7.X
 
*SME Server 7.X
 +
*SME Server 8.X
 +
*SME Server 9.X
  
 
=== Installation ===
 
=== Installation ===

Revision as of 18:45, 27 September 2015



Mainteneur

Daniel B. de Firewall Services

Version

Contrib 10:
Contrib 9:
smeserver-bridge-interface
The latest version of smeserver-bridge-interface is available in the SME repository, click on the version number(s) for more information.


Description

smeserver-bridge-interface est un petit paquet qui permet de faire un pont (souvent appelé "bridge") entre votre interface interne et une ou plusieurs interfaces virtuelles TAP. Cette contrib est prévue pour fonctionner avec OpenVPN-Bridge, mais elle peut être utile dans d'autres situations (si vous voulez exécuter une machine virtuelle sur votre serveur SME avec qemu par exemple).

Exigences

  • SME Server 7.X
  • SME Server 8.X
  • SME Server 9.X

Installation

  • installez les rpms
yum --enablerepo=smecontribs install smeserver-bridge-interface
  • Configurez le pont

Connectez-vous à votre serveur par SSH, et configurer le pont comme vous voulez. Pour la plupart des installations, les paramètres par défaut devraient convenir, mais vous devriez vérifier :

db configuration show bridge
bridge=service
    bridgeInterface=br0
    ethernetInterface=eth0
    status=enabled
    tapInterface=tap0


    • bridgeInterface: (br0) est le nom du périphérique pont (habituellement br0)
    • ethernetInterface: (eth0|eth1) est l'interface réelle que vous utilisez pour le pont. Le paramètre par défaut devrait indiquer le nom de votre interface interne.
Warning.png Warning:
La contrib bridge n'est pas compatible avec l'option de liaison d'interfaces (NIC bonding). Si vous êtes en mode serveronly et employez la liaison d'interfaces, vous devriez la désactiver avant de mettre en fonction le pont. Pour cela, vous pouvez utiliser la console d'administration, directement en vous loguant en tant qu'utilisateur admin ou en tant que root après avoir tapé la commande console


    • tapInterface: (tap0,tap1) est une liste séparée par des virgules des interfaces tap à créer et à ajouter au pont. La plupart du temps, vous n'aurez besoin que d'une interface tap (tap0)
    • status: (enabled|disabled) est l'état du service (il devrait être lancé automatiquement au démarrage)

Une fois que vous êtes sûr que tout est OK, vous pouvez démarrer le service :

/etc/init.d/bridge start

Et vérifier avec ifconfig que tout est OK (eth0 et tap0 devraient avoir 0.0.0.0 comme adresse IP et devraient être configurés en mode promiscous, br0 devrait avoir l'IP de votre interface interne)

Vous pouvez également consulter si le pont est correctement configuré

brctl show br0

Devrait produire quelque chose comme :

bridge name     bridge id               STP enabled     interfaces
br0             8000.00e04c101418       no              eth0
                                                        tap0

Désinstallation

Si vous supprimez cette contrib alors qu'elle est en cours d'utilisation, vous pouvez avoir un problème bloquant br0 (waiting for br0 to become free, etc ..), et vous devrez redémarrer de votre serveur. Pour éviter cela, vous devez

  • Désactivez le service
db configuration setprop bridge status disabled
Warning.png Warning:
N'oubliez pas que si vous désactivez le service, OpenVPN_Bridge cessera de fonctionner, donc si vous l'avez installé, vous devez le désactiver ou le supprimer aussi


  • Redémarrez votre serveur, le pont ne démarrera pas
  • Supprimer le rpm
yum remove smeserver-bridge-interface
Warning.png Warning:
signal-event post-upgrade; signal-event reboot peut être nécessaire au cas où le système perd l'interface interne


Source

La source de cette contrib peut être trouvé dans le dépôt CVS sur sourceforge.

Bugs

Merci de faire remonter les problèmes sur bugzilla en sélectionnant le logiciel smeserver-bridge-interface ou en utilisant ce lien